70 years since the PIZ BUIN® mountain inspired a man to invent the world's first sun protection cream
The PIZ BUIN® brand traces its origin back to the inspiration of Franz Greiter, a young chemistry student, who suffered severe sunburn while climbing PIZ BUIN®, a mountain on the Swiss-Austrian border, in 1938. In a small laboratory in his parents' home, he formulated a product that would protect the skin against the adverse effects of the sun, a product that would later become known as PIZ BUIN®.
A long string of firsts in the field of sun protection can be credited to the pioneering spirit of Franz Greiter, which subsequently made the PIZ BUIN® brand famous all over the world. - 2009 - The PIZ BUIN® Active sunscreens with resistant protection are launched in order to meet the demands of an active lifestyle in the sun.
- 2008 - PIZ BUIN® presents sunscreen in its most convenient form – the PIZ BUIN Sunband. It encourages sun-smart behaviour and guarantees that great protection is only an arm’s length away.
- 2008 - The complete PIZ BUIN® suncare range is upgraded to the new breakthrough sun protection technology Helioplex™ – a new class of gorgeous protection from PIZ BUIN®.
- 2007 - Launch of Tan Intensifier – a range of products with an innovative formulation that facilitates faster tanning without compromising on protection.
- 2006 - PIZ BUIN® celebrates its 60th anniversary and introduces PIZ BUIN® Self Tan and PIZ BUIN® Gradual Self Tan product lines.
- 2005 - PIZ BUIN® launches its latest suncare innovation, PIZ BUIN® 1 Day Long. With its unique "bonding" technology (patent pending), the new PIZ BUIN® 1 Day Long sun lotion represents a major development in suncare. It provides consumers with long-lasting UVA-UVB sun protection with a single application.
- 2002 - Introduction of a complete suncare range with photostable UVA and UVB filters.
- 1993 - PIZ BUIN® develops the first Triple Protection Technology; all sun protection formulations contain UVA and UVB filters, as well as Vitamin E, which neutralises skin cell-damaging free radicals.
- 1989 - For the first time, PIZ BUIN® uses filters known as micro-pigments that reflect UV light.
- 1980 - PIZ BUIN® introduces a range of products specifically designed for the mountains, which provide special protection from the sun.
- 1975 - The first water-resistant suncare products are developed by PIZ BUIN®.
- 1968 - PIZ BUIN® introduces sunscreens with UVA and UVB broad spectrum filters.
- 1962 - Introduction of the Sun Protection Factor (SPF), which has now become a worldwide standard.
- 1946 - Prof. Franz Greiter invents the world's first sun protection product.
